Construction injury cases often involve overlapping issues of workers’ compensation, third-party liability, and personal injury law. Many victims sustain spinal cord or brain injuries, fractures, or nerve damage that prevent them from returning to work. The firm’s attorneys pursue both workers’ compensation benefits and third-party claims in cases involving equipment defects or negligent site supervision. This dual approach often results in broader financial recovery for victims while encouraging stricter safety standards industry-wide.
The Weitz Firm also represents pedestrians, delivery drivers, and nearby residents injured in construction-related accidents, including those caused by falling debris, unsafe traffic control, or defective materials. Each case undergoes a detailed investigation to identify every responsible party—from general contractors and subcontractors to architects and manufacturers.
